Section 3333.131 | Rural Practice Incentive Program.

There is hereby created the rural practice incentive program, which shall be administered by the chancellor of higher education. The purpose of the program is to provide loan repayment on behalf of attorneys who agree to employment or practice as service attorneys in areas designated as underserved communities by the chancellor pursuant to section 3333.132 of the Revised Code.

Under the program, the chancellor may agree to repay up to the amount set pursuant to section 3333.135 of the Revised Code of the principal and interest of a government or other educational loan taken by an individual for the following expenses, so long as the expenses were incurred while the individual was enrolled in a law school that meets accreditation standards established by the Ohio supreme court:

(A) Tuition;

(B) Other educational expenses, such as fees, books, and expenses, for specific purposes and in amounts determined to be reasonable by the chancellor;

(C) Room and board, in an amount determined reasonable by the chancellor.
